The Door in the Floor

The Gist: A summer in the life of a wealthy couple, whose marriage has hit the skids. They seem to still care for one another on some level, but the chasm is too wide to cross. One day, the husband hires a young guy to be his assistant, who will ultimately bring a much needed jolt to their relationship.

The Door in the Floor was a very interesting movie to watch. The downward spiraling marriage of the couple and their interactions with the new assistant are engaging enough, but when the reason for their marital problems is finally revealed, it's like a punch to the stomach.

Jeff Bridges, Kim Basinger, and Jon Foster are perfectly cast, and even little Elle Fanning shines as the little girl caught in the middle.

The Bottom Line: This is a really, really good movie that has clearly been overlooked (I can't believe it doesn't have a better rating on IMDb). I would wholeheartedly recommend it to anyone. It will stay with you long after you've watched it.

Grade: 9
